Bio:
Sweet and gentle west coast writer, Beth Robinson, blends her skillful acoustic guitar with a strong, clear voice on songs chronicling personal insights, often about members of the opposite sex. This life feels rich and carefully explored; one that listeners will enjoy revisiting. Her songs are intensely personal yet accessible, her voice has a lush velvety quality to it, and her style is vulnerable and unpretentious. Her first album of all original tunes, called "Heart of a Hunter" is a stylish collection of moods and grooves that take you along on an intimate journey. It was produced and arranged by Doug Blumer (formerly of the Westerleys). Doug brings his own heart warming guitar licks and vocal harmonies, as well as a pure country/rock sensibility, which makes for a rich mix of instrumentation behind Beth's moving and heart-felt vocals and lyrics.

Music Background
I was born and raised in NYC. I went to Music & Art Highschool up in Harlem, next to NYU & Columbia. Just in time for all the war protesting and demonstrations against the war in Vietnam. I was a true, card carrying hippy and I missed Woodstock by only a few years. I played guitar and sang and wrote folk songs with friends in the village but it was more of a healing self expression -- very personal -- too tender to share with the general public. I got my first and ONLY real guitar as a graduation gift from Manny's music store on West 47th Street. It was a '65 Gibson Hummingbird. It was a lifeline, my shy connection to the world. But as I got more involved in the job market and making money, and just making it in this world, I ran out of time and the need for music. I put it aside, moved to California, married, developed a career, watched the wheels of life grind inevitably forward and away from my past. Until I came to a crossroads right here in the middle of my life. I had to decide which road would lead me back to who I really wanted to be. The Hummingbird was still there, and all of it's healing powers. And the songs were still there just waiting to be sung.
Music Skills
All kinds of guitar lessons from classical to folk, but most notably, two excrutiatingly intense years of music theory with the bay area treasure Nina Gerber. I'm still recovering from that experience.
